diff options
author | Archzfs Buildbot | 2018-09-08 10:26:47 +0000 |
---|---|---|
committer | Archzfs Buildbot | 2018-09-08 10:26:47 +0000 |
commit | 4c41c79867d2add1539aa27ac11bcda2c6439b09 (patch) | |
tree | 37a127f2c788ad3f658ba352bbd0e231cbd8b573 /PKGBUILD | |
parent | 38c3086ef8929d325dc9f11c5b4cc0482cee9453 (diff) | |
download | aur-4c41c79867d2add1539aa27ac11bcda2c6439b09.tar.gz |
Semi-automated update for kernel 4.18.6.arch1-1 + latest git commit
Diffstat (limited to 'PKGBUILD')
-rw-r--r-- | PKGBUILD | 31 |
1 files changed, 14 insertions, 17 deletions
@@ -15,34 +15,31 @@ # packages for your favorite kernel package built using the archzfs build tools, submit a request in the Issue tracker on the # archzfs github page. # -# pkgbase="zfs-linux-git" pkgname=("zfs-linux-git" "zfs-linux-git-headers") +_commit='b8a90418f3a9c23b89c5d2c729a4dd0fea644508' +_zfsver="2018.09.07.r4720.gb8a90418f" +_kernelver="4.18.6.arch1-1" +_extramodules="${_kernelver/.arch/-arch}-ARCH" -pkgver=2018.08.23.r4692.g55972a672.4.18.5.arch1.1 +pkgver="${_zfsver}_$(echo ${_kernelver} | sed s/-/./g)" pkgrel=1 -makedepends=("linux-headers=4.18.5.arch1-1" "git") +makedepends=("linux-headers=${_kernelver}" "git") arch=("x86_64") url="http://zfsonlinux.org/" -source=("git+https://github.com/zfsonlinux/zfs.git#commit=55972a6724ca49d98d67a47fe0f0b28ad21260d5" - "upstream-ac09630-Fix-zpl_mount-deadlock.patch" - "upstream-9f64c1e-Linux-4.18-compat-inode-timespec_timespec64.patch" - "upstream-9161ace-Linux-compat-4.18-check_disk_size_change.patch") -sha256sums=("SKIP" - "1799f6f7b2a60a23b66106c9470414628398f6bfc10da3d0f41c548bba6130e8" - "03ed45af40850c3a51a6fd14f36c1adc06501c688a67afb13db4fded6ec9db1d" - "afbde4a2507dff989404665dbbdfe18eecf5aba716a6513902affa0e4cb033fe") +source=("git+https://github.com/zfsonlinux/zfs.git#commit=${_commit}") +sha256sums=("SKIP") license=("CDDL") -depends=("kmod" "zfs-utils-common-git=2018.08.23.r4692.g55972a672" "linux=4.18.5.arch1-1") +depends=("kmod" "zfs-utils-common-git=${_zfsver}" "linux=${_kernelver}") build() { cd "${srcdir}/zfs" ./autogen.sh ./configure --prefix=/usr --sysconfdir=/etc --sbindir=/usr/bin --libdir=/usr/lib \ --datadir=/usr/share --includedir=/usr/include --with-udevdir=/lib/udev \ - --libexecdir=/usr/lib/zfs-0.7.9 --with-config=kernel \ - --with-linux=/usr/lib/modules/4.18.5-arch1-1-ARCH/build \ - --with-linux-obj=/usr/lib/modules/4.18.5-arch1-1-ARCH/build + --libexecdir=/usr/lib/zfs-${zfsver} --with-config=kernel \ + --with-linux=/usr/lib/modules/${_extramodules}/build \ + --with-linux-obj=/usr/lib/modules/${_extramodules}/build make } @@ -51,7 +48,7 @@ package_zfs-linux-git() { install=zfs.install provides=("zfs") groups=("archzfs-linux-git") - conflicts=('zfs-linux' 'spl-linux-git') + conflicts=('zfs-linux' 'spl-linux-git' 'spl-linux') replaces=("spl-linux-git") cd "${srcdir}/zfs" make DESTDIR="${pkgdir}" install @@ -68,5 +65,5 @@ package_zfs-linux-git-headers() { make DESTDIR="${pkgdir}" install rm -r "${pkgdir}/lib" # Remove reference to ${srcdir} - sed -i "s+${srcdir}++" ${pkgdir}/usr/src/zfs-*/4.18.5-arch1-1-ARCH/Module.symvers + sed -i "s+${srcdir}++" ${pkgdir}/usr/src/zfs-*/${_extramodules}/Module.symvers } |